Our specialized cored wire is meticulously categorized, based on the core material composition, into two distinct types: single and composite:
1) Single Cored Wire: This unique type is characterized by having a single alloy powder or a powdery nonmetallic compound additive at its core, ensuring focused metallurgical enhancement.
2) Composite Cored Wire: A sophisticated blend, this variant incorporates two or more alloy powders as its core, offering a multiplied effect in metallurgical applications.
Ingeniously classified into inner tap type and outer tap type, the cored wire's arrangement is engineered to cater to diverse application needs.
Our cored wire is a vital component in steel purification, elevating the quality of molten steel, streamlining casting conditions, and optimally enhancing overall steel performance. It efficiently maximizes alloy yield, curtails alloy usage, and significantly lowers steelmaking costs.
